A- Tallboy pours into the classic Duvel glass with a mostly clear pale golden yellow body and a fizzy white head. The cap dies out very quickly to just about nothing. Lacing just not happening here.
S- Mostly influenced by the hops and the bugs here with coriander seemingly missing from the aroma. The bugs bring some mustiness, funk and bready tones along with the lactic acid. Hops compliment this with grapefruit, slight dank and slight tropical hints.
T- Showcases a few main flavors with the fermentation and the Citra really in the spotlight. Grapefruit, lime zest and generally citrus forward hops atop a base of clean lactic acid, musty sour pale fruits and grainy bread. There is a generally herbal and citrus quality here but it does not scream coriander. A hint of juicy fruits like melon bubble gum seems to fade in and out in some sips.
MF- A light and somewhat thin body as it lacks a true substantial texture. HIgh level of the bubbles and a light tartness lingers in the finish.
Citra and a well fermented lactic sour are indeed a good combination. Castle Island has pulled it off here with the citrus, fruity hops accentuated by the lactic acid and grainy base. Appearance and mouthfeel a bit of a letdown but the important characteristics are just fine.

Canned 9 weeks ago.
L -- Somewhat hazy yellow body with a three-finger head produced with well-aerated pour out of the can. Minimal retention or lacing.
S -- Citrus, must, bread, and a mild funky yeastiness.
T -- Very gose-like. Some floral hoppiness, but the predominant flavors are lemon, wheat, salt, and coriander
F -- Refreshing and quaffable. Medium+ carb and light mouthfeel. Minimal aftertaste
O -- The dry hopping works well and this beer stays fresh tasting for much longer than most brews of the same ilk. Price tag of ~$13/4-pack of 16oz cans is a little on the steep side given the ABV.
81/100

Pours hazy, straw yellow in color with ΒΌ inch head. Taste is lemon, straw, and a decent amount of tartness/sourness. Very light bodied, tart, with medium-high carbonation. Makes for a nice, light, and very pleasant sour ale. Not the most complex of beers, but certainly one I could see myself having several of, especially on a hot day. A good beer worth trying.
